But, in the meantime, here's the picture of my new yearly tradition, cucumber sushi.

 I'm not a big fan of seaweed, so I was quite pleased to run across this recipe last year.  It's delicious and beautiful all at once, and a nice way to use cucumbers when your garden has too many and you're running out of ideas.  This year I forgot to add the ginger in with the rice, and so I dug out an old box of candied ginger I had for some reason or other.  I put little bits on top of the sushi, and it was such an amazing improvement, both visually and for the taste buds.  Marvelous!  I'll never do it any other way now.
